Why a Sharps Container for Home Use Is Necessary
I learned very quickly that keeping used needles, lancets, and other sharp medical items in a regular trash can is not safe. Even at home, these items can accidentally poke me, my family, or anyone handling the garbage. A sharps container gives me a secure place to store them right away, so I can reduce the risk of injury and keep my home safer.
I also find that a proper sharps container helps me stay organized and responsible with my medical waste. When I use it, I know I am not mixing dangerous items with everyday trash. That makes disposal much easier and helps me follow safe health practices, especially if I need injections, blood sugar testing, or other at-home treatments.
For me, using a sharps container is also about peace of mind. I do not have to worry about a needle slipping through a bag or causing harm later. It is a simple step, but it makes a big difference in protecting my household and making sure I handle medical supplies the right way.
My Buying Guides on Sharps Container For Home Use
When I started looking for a sharps container for home use, I realized there are a few important things to check before buying one. Since I would be disposing of needles, lancets, and other sharp medical items at home, I wanted something safe, convenient, and easy to manage. Here’s what I learned from my own research and experience.
1. Size and Capacity
The first thing I considered was the size. I needed a container that could fit my regular disposal needs without taking up too much space. If I only use a few needles or lancets each week, a smaller container may be enough. But if I use sharps more often, I would choose a larger one so I don’t have to replace it too quickly.
2. Safety Features
Safety was my top priority. I looked for a sharps container with a secure lid, puncture-resistant walls, and a design that prevents accidental spills or needle sticks. I wanted to make sure that once I placed a sharp item inside, it would stay safely contained until disposal.
3. Easy-to-Use Opening
I found that the opening matters a lot. It should be wide enough for easy disposal, but not so large that it creates a safety risk. For home use, I prefer a container that allows me to drop items in quickly without struggling, especially when I’m in a hurry.
4. Locking Mechanism
A good locking mechanism gives me peace of mind. I like containers that can be securely closed once full, so nothing can fall out. This is especially important if there are children or pets in the home.
5. Placement and Storage
I also thought about where I would keep the container. For home use, I wanted something compact enough to store in a bathroom, bedroom, or medical supply area. A container that fits neatly on a shelf or inside a cabinet works best for me.
6. Disposal and Replacement
Before buying, I checked how the container would be disposed of when full. Some areas have special medical waste disposal rules, so I made sure I understood the local requirements. I also looked for a product that is easy to replace when needed.
7. Material Quality
The material should be strong and durable. I prefer a container made from thick, puncture-resistant plastic because it helps prevent leaks and breaks. A flimsy container would not give me the confidence I need for safe home disposal.
8. Labeling and Instructions
I like containers that come clearly labeled with warning symbols and simple instructions. This makes it easier for me to use them correctly and helps remind everyone in the home that the contents are hazardous.
9. Portability
If I need to move the container between rooms or take it to a disposal site, portability becomes important. A lightweight container with a carry handle is very useful for home users like me.
10. Price and Value
Finally, I compared price with quality. I didn’t want to buy the cheapest option if it meant compromising safety. For me, the best sharps container is one that offers good protection, practical size, and long-lasting use at a reasonable price.
